"iGaming" -de kompýuter görüşi
1) Näme üçin iGaming platformasyna CV paýlaýjylary
KYC/AML: OCR resminamalary, hakykylygyny barlamak, ýaşamak/anti-spoofing.
Antifrod/töwekgelçilik: botlaryň/multiakkauntlaryň detekasiýasy (özüni alyp baryş + wizual), "ekran-paýlaşmak" we proksi-enjamlary kesgitlemek.
Marketing/ASO: döredijilik moderasiýasy (tekst/nyşanlar/reýting 18 +), marka-seýfi, A/B wizual elementler.
Amallar/QA: UI awtomatiki regress synaglary, laglaryň/boýaglaryň wizual telemetri.
Akymlar/sosial ulgamlar: wakalary, logotipleri, oýunlary/üpjün edijileri, äheňleri we düzgün bozmalary çykarmak.
Responsible Gaming: wizual aragatnaşyga gözegçilik (ejiz toparlar üçin agressiw nagyşlaryň ýoklugy).
2) Esasy ssenariýalar we çözgütler
2. 1 KYC: resminama + adam
OCR: resminamanyň doly adyny/senesini/belgisini çykarmak, formaty tassyklamak, arza bilen deňeşdirmek.
Face match: selfini resminamadaky surat bilen deňeşdirmek.
Liveness: passiw alamatlar (micro-motion, Moiré, blink) we işjeň (prompt-challenge).
Resminamanyň hakykylygy: suw belgileri/fontlar/mikro çap etmek, fotoşop deteksiýasy.
2. 2 Antifrod we howpsuzlyk
Device cam check (rugsat edilýän ýerde): ekrandan/maskadan oýnamagyň alamatlary.
Multiakkaunt: CV signallaryny (selfi/fon) özüňi alyp baryş we enjam grafasy bilen birleşdirmek.
Mazmun syýasaty: açyk kanallarda töleg kartlarynyň/pasportlarynyň şekillerini blokirlemek.
2. 3 Marketing/döredijilik/ASO
Moderasiýa: gadagan simwollaryň/şygarlaryň, "18", QR/baglanyşyklaryň, nyrhlaryň detekasiýasy.
Marka-seýfi: logotip, reňk, ýerleşiş boýunça gollanmalara laýyklyk.
A/B: kompozisiýany awtomatiki seljermek (CTA, kontrast, "iş ýüki"), CTR/CR bilen baglanyşyk.
2. 4 Akymlar we wideolar (oýunlar/eSports/täsir edijiler)
Logo/Game detection: üpjün edijileriň mahabat hasaplaýjylary.
Highlight mining: wakalar boýunça klipler (uly ýeňiş/şowsuzlyk/baglanyşyk kesilmegi).
Wideo moderasiýasy: R-reýting, görkeziş/ýurisdiksiýa sagady boýunça humarly mazmun.
2. 5 UI/QA
Wizual regressiýa: sahypalar/wersiýalar/enjamlar boýunça skrinshotlary deňeşdirmek.
Optiki telemetriýa: kadr-taýmingler, renderiň geçişleri, "ýalpyldawuk" elementler.
Accessibility: kreatiwlerde we sahypalarda kontrast/kegl/alt-teksti barlamak.
3) Arhitektura we ýerleşdiriş
On-device (ykjam SDK, WebAssembly): çarçuwasyz liveness/OCR (privacy by default).
Edge (RoR/Sebit): maglumatlaryň/açarlaryň pes gizlinligi we geo-izolýasiýasy.
Bulut: agyr modeller (deteksiýa, segmentasiýa, wideo-analiz), asinxron meseleler.
Gizlin inferens: VIP/tölegler üçin TEE/SGX; goralýan konweýerler.
Gibrid: enjamda aňsat deslapky synag → edge/cloud-da takyk barlag.
4) Maglumatlar we augmentasiýalar
Ýygnamak: razylyk, PII gizlemek, saklamak geo-syýasaty.
Sintetika: yşyklandyryş/burç/ses üýtgemeleri bilen resminamalar/selfi döretmek; domain randomization.
Augmentasiýalar: blur, motion, glare, print-scan, ekran-ekrana (ekran re-capture), JPEG-artefaktlar.
Balans: "spuf", "ekrandan surat", "maska", "multiekspozisiýa" synplary - azyndan oňyn.
Bellik: işjeň okuw; Jedelli ýagdaýlaryň QA-iki gezek barlagy.
5) Modeller we nusgalar
Klassifikasiýa/detekasiýa: YOLOv8/YOLOv9, EfficientDet, ViT/DETR; logotipler üçin - ýöriteleşdirilen detektorlar.
Segmentasiýa: SegFormer/Mask2Former (fon/maskalar, konturly resminama).
OCR: TrOCR/ABINet/CRNN + rectification; köp dilli goldaw.
Face: ArcFace/FaceNet embedding; Anti-spoof CNN/ViT; mikro hereketler boýunça liveness.
Wideo: SlowFast/X3D/TimeSformer; highlightlar üçin - waka klassifikatorlary + Energy-based süzgüçleri.
Multimodallyk: Döredijilik üçin CLIP meňzeş modeller (surat + tekst).
6) Paýlaýynlar (ahyrky görnüş)
6. 1 KYC/Liveness (edge + bulut)
1. On-device: kadr-kwalifikator (ýiti/yşyklandyryş) → passiw liveness.
2. Edge: OCR resminama, face-embeddingi deňeşdirme, spuf-çek; töwekgelçilik-çalt.
3. Bulut: jedelli ýagdaýlary el bilen barlamak (HITL), audit, DSAR-log.
6. 2 Döredijilik moderasiýasy
1. Ingest döredijilik (DAM/adminka) →
2. Teksti/nyşanlary/logotipleri kesgitlemek →
3. Ýurisdiksiýalar boýunça "allow/flag/deny" klassifikasiýasy →
4. Mahabat hereketlendirijisine API + hasabat.
6. 3 Wizual regressiýa UI
1. Enjamlar/lokallar boýunça ssenariler/ekran suratlary generatory →
2. Per-piksel/per-obýekt deňeşdirme + toleranslar →
3. PR/CI-de alert; otomatik surata düşmek.
7) Hil ölçegleri we SLO
Goşmaça: Deri/yşyklandyryş/kamera boýunça Bias/Fairness; Privacy (nol PII-çarçuwalaryň syzmagy).
8) Howpsuzlyk, gizlinlik we gabat gelmek
Biometrics-by-design: minimallaşdyrmak/lokalizasiýa (on-device), şifrlemek, syýasat boýunça saklanyş möhleti.
Ýüz embeddingleriniň belligi, yzyna dolanyp gelmegiň gadagan edilmegi, aýratyn açarlar.
DSAR/aýyrmak: subýektiň belligi boýunça gözlemek, kripto silmek.
Legal Hold: Derňew üçin wideo/çarçuwalary doňdurmak.
Ýurisdiksiýalar: maglumatlaryň/açarlaryň geo-izolýasiýasy, 18 +/mahabatyň dürli düzgünleri.
Audit: infensa/çözgütleriň üýtgemeýän ýazgylary (WORM), serhet ýagdaýlarynyň düşündirilmegi.
Hüjümçileriň hileleri: re-capture, adversarial-pattern, rate limiting.
9) Syn etmek we alertler
Onlaýn metrikler: latency p50/95/99, error rate, saturations (GPU/CPU/IO).
Hil: yşyklandyryş/kameralar/ýurtlar boýunça drift; APCER ýa-da FPR ösüşi.
Operasiýa: jedelli ýagdaýlaryň nobaty, el bilen barlamagyň SLA.
Alertler: deny-geçişleriň/ýalan täsirleriň köpelmegi, OCR-takyklygyň peselmegi.
10) Integrasiýa (API/şertnamalar)
10. 1 KYC hyzmaty
yaml api: /v1/kyc/check request:
selfie: image_token document_front: image_token document_back: image_token country: "EE"
purpose: "account_opening"
response:
scores: {face_match: 0.93, spoof: 0.02}
ocr: {name: "IVAN IVANOV", dob: "1994-02-14"}
decision: "allow manual deny"
trace_id: "..."
privacy: {pii: true, tokenized: true}
10. 2 Döredijilik moderasiýasy
yaml api: /v1/creative/moderate request: {image_token: "...", market: "TR", channel: "display"}
response:
violations: ["age_rating_missing","prohibited_text"]
decision: "deny"
trace_id: "..."
11) CV üçin MLOps
Registry: model/data/augmentasiýa/wersiýa; ulanmagyň çäklendirilmegi.
Neşirler: shadow/canary/blue-green, rollback by FPR/latency.
Synaglar: "agyr" haltalar bilen altyn-set (maskalar, ýalpyldawuk plastmassa, ekran-gaýtadan).
Monitoring: drift light-fich (ýagtylyk, ýitilik), bias-hasabatlar.
Cost: INT8/FP16, sparsity, batch-size, processing keş, routing "ýeňil/agyr" model.
12) Şablonlar (ulanmaga taýýar)
12. 1 Içgysgynç syýasaty (SLO/Privacy)
yaml cv_service: vision.core slo:
p95_latency_ms: 300 success_rate: 0.995 privacy:
store_frames: false biometrics_tokenized: true retention: "P30D"
monitoring:
spoof_apcer_max: 0.03 ocr_cer_max: 0.06 bias_gap_pp_max: 3
12. 2 KYC modulyny işe girizmegiň barlag sanawy
- On-device prevalidasiýa we passiw liveness goşuldy
- CER/WER golden setde ≤ bosagada
- Kameralar/yşyklandyryş/resminamalaryň görnüşleri boýunça bias-hasabat
- Shadow 5-10% arzalar, jedelli el bilen gözden geçirmek
- DSAR/Silmek we Legal Hold barlandy
- APCER/BPCER we latency alertleri
12. 3 Runbook "APCER-iň ösüşi"
1. Daşbordy kameralar/ýurtlar boýunça barlamak; "gyzgyn" segmentleri kesgitlemek.
2. Bu segmentlerde Edge-de "agyr" anti-spuff modeline geçiň.
3. Bosagalary berkitmek, işjeň çeki açmak (blink/prompt).
4. Augmentasiýalary we golden-seti täzelemek; post-mortem.
13) Durmuşa geçirmegiň ýol kartasy
0-30 gün (MVP)
1. KYC: OCR + esasy face-match, passiw liveness on-device, jedelleri el bilen barlamak.
2. Döredijilik moderasiýasy: düzgünler + tekst/logotip detektory; ýurisdiksiýalar boýunça deny-listi.
3. UI regressiýasy: ýokary ekranlaryň wiz suratlary, diff% PR-gate.
30-90 gün
1. Anti-spuf ViT, işjeň senagat önümleri; resminamalaryň sintetikasy/selfi.
2. Akym wideo seljermesi: logo/highlights; üpjün edijilere hasabat.
3. bias/fairness hasabatlary, drift monitoringi; canary-relizler, SLO aladalary.
3-6 aý
1. VIP/tölegler üçin gizlin inferens (TEE).
2. CR/ARPPU-da baglanyşygy bolan marka-seýfiň we A/B döredijiligiň doly gözegçiligi.
3. Jedelli ýagdaýlardan golden-setleri awto-öndürmek; çempion-challenger konfigi.
4. Gol çekilen webhuk boýunça üpjün edijiler/CUS-hyzmatdaşlar bilen daşarky integrasiýa.
14) Anti-patternler
"Çig" işgärleri zerurlyksyz we möhletsiz saklamak; PII-den loglar.
Liveness diňe işjeň (passiw däl) ýa-da tersine.
Ähli ýurtlar/kameralar/sahnalar üçin ähliumumy bosagalar (möwsümlilik/yşyklandyryş ignory).
Golden-set we bias-auditiň ýoklugy → "ortaça gowy, gyralarda erbet".
Profillemezden we latency/baha býudjetsiz agyr modelleri işe girizmek.
Döredijilik moderasiýasy çykmazdan ozal "soňky ädim" - gymmat we giç.
15) Baglanyşykly bölümler
KYC/AML we Access Control, DataOps-Practices, MLOps: Modelleriň işleýşi, analitikanyň we metrikanyň API-leri, Synlaryň sentiment-derňewi, Maglumat akymlarynyň aladalary, Maglumatlaryň etikasy we aç-açanlygy, Maglumatlary saklamak syýasaty.
Jemi
Kompýuter görüşi - "aýratyn nerw ulgamy" däl-de, maglumatlaryň we töwekgelçilikleriň önümçilik konweýeriniň bir bölegi: on-device gizlinlikden we geo-izolýasiýadan MLOps we hil alertlerine çenli. Dogry CV arhitekturasy frod we el barlaglaryny azaldýar, KYC-ni çaltlaşdyrýar, marketingi howpsuz we ölçegli edýär we önüm has durnukly we elýeterli bolýar.